Overview
This Physics (Hons) degree offered by the Loughborough University combines core physics content and astrophysics with the full range of our optional modules that take advantage of Loughborough’s research strengths in for example, quantum physics, modern optics, condensed matter, the physics of materials, statistical physics, and medical physics.
Your future career
- A degree in Physics can lead to many and varied career opportunities. We strive to develop knowledge and practical abilities in our students that are valued in the workplace, including interpersonal and presentation skills.
- Our excellent industry links within the Department of Physics is a correlation to the strong track record in graduate employability. Our students graduate with transferable skills and are equipped with the necessary practical and theoretical knowledge required to progress in a professional science related career. The wide-ranging transferable skills allow our students to pursue non-physics careers such as education, management, and finance.

Other requirements
General requirements
- ABB including Maths and Physics (Applicants without A level Physics may be considered on a case by case basis)
- 34 (6,5,5 HL) including Maths and Physics at HL
- BTEC Level 3 National Extended Diploma in Applied Science or Engineering: DDD with Distinctions in units 1-5 (Applied Science) or in units 1, 7, 8, 19 - 21, 25, 29 or 31 or 35 (Engineering) plus A Level Maths grade B.
- BTEC Level 3 National Diploma in Applied Science or in Engineering Grades Distinction Distinction including Distinctions in units 1-5 (Applied Science) or in units 1, 7, 8, 19 - 21, 25, 29 or 31 or 35 (Engineering) plus A Level Grade B in Maths.
- GCSE English Language Grade 4/C
